1. Seed bearing plants
a) What do you understand by pollination? Pollination is the transfer of pollen grains from the anther (male reproductive part) to the stigma (female receptive part) of a flower. This process is crucial for sexual reproduction in flowering plants, leading to fertilization and subsequent seed formation.
